The ABAP RESTful Application Programming Model (RAP) offers a set of concepts, tools, languages, and powerful frameworks on the ABAP platform to efficiently build innovative and cloud-ready SAP Fiori applications and Web APIs from scratch or by reusing existing code. RAP is available on SAP BTP ABAP Environment (aka Steampunk), SAP S/4HANA, and SAP S/4HANA Cloud.

But which legacy ABAP code can be reused in RAP? What must developers do to ensure the transactional consistency of the SAP Logical Work of Unit (LUW) when working with RAP? These questions and more will be discussed in this webcast.
